【文件属性】:
文件名称:部署:docker-compose部署
文件大小:33KB
文件格式:ZIP
更新时间:2021-02-23 04:43:56
golang continuous-delivery docker-compose Go
部署
docker-compose部署API
curl -O https://raw.githubusercontent.com/ViBiOh/deploy/main/deploy
chmod +x deploy
./deploy PROJECT_NAME DOCKER-COMPOSE-FILE
Usage: deploy [PROJECT_NAME] [DOCKER-COMPOSE-FILE]
where
- PROJECT_NAME Name of your compose project
- DOCKER_COMPOSE_FILE Path to your compose file (default: docker-compose.yml in current dir)
Golang API
您可以通过HTTP API执行deploy脚本。
【文件预览】:
deploy-main
----.gitignore(62B)
----go.mod(127B)
----Dockerfile(330B)
----.sonarcloud.properties(0B)
----Makefile(2KB)
----pkg()
--------api()
--------annotation()
----LICENSE(1KB)
----clean(212B)
----go.sum(42KB)
----docker-compose.yml(1KB)
----.github()
--------CODEOWNERS(10B)
--------workflows()
--------dependabot.yml(350B)
----README.md(5KB)
----deploy(929B)
----cmd()
--------deploy()
----.editorconfig(216B)